The Road to Christmas: a musical journey from Advent to Epiphany

1 December 2018, 7.30pm
University Church of St Mary the Virgin, Oxford

Join us for an evocative choral excursion through the Christmas story, featuring the music of Jonathan Dove, Vaughan Williams, Britten, Tavener, Kodaly and many more … with a few mince pies and some mulled wine for the road. 

Our Christmas journey begins with the heightened expectations of Advent—the wondrous music of this season is often overlooked in the mad rush of shopping and carol concerts—then takes us through the Nativity story by way of a few familiar and not so familiar carols, before leading us into a musical Epiphany.
